// Models std::flat_set close enough to test if no ambiguous lookup of a
// formatter happens due to the flat_set type matching is_set and
// is_container_adaptor_like
template <typename T> class flat_set {
public:
using key_type = T;
using container_type = std::vector<T>;

using iterator = typename std::vector<T>::iterator;
using const_iterator = typename std::vector<T>::const_iterator;

template <typename... Ts>
explicit flat_set(Ts&&... args) : c{std::forward<Ts>(args)...} {}

iterator begin() { return c.begin(); }
const_iterator begin() const { return c.begin(); }

iterator end() { return c.end(); }
const_iterator end() const { return c.end(); }

private:
std::vector<T> c;
};

TEST(ranges_test, format_flat_set) {
EXPECT_EQ(fmt::format("{}", flat_set<std::string>{"one", "two"}),
"{\"one\", \"two\"}");
}
